Position: Electrical Tester (High Voltage) - 1st Shift

Team: Quality Team

 

Primary Objective of Position:

A Tester provides validated product performance data by performing test setup, operation, troubleshooting, calibration and reporting. Internally we refer to this position as a Tester.

 

Major Areas of Accountability:

  • Set up, connect, test and adjust test items such as motors, generators, control equipment and specifically designed power apparatus to meet IEEE, API, NEMA and other product specifications.
  • Read information pertaining to apparatus to be tested, such as production order, engineering data sheets, process specifications, test specifications, and drawings.
  • Prepare data sheets, test plans and reports electronically to meet internal and external customer requirements.
  • Use auxiliary testing apparatus such as pony brakes, generators, voltmeters, ammeters, dynamometers, driving motors, tachometers, meggers and high-pot equipment.
  • Check machines for common defects before setup and, if found, reports to supervisor for proper disposition.
  • Connect test unit through necessary meters, generators, shunts, instrument transformers, resistors, reactors or other apparatus as required.
  • Collect, record and analyze data for comparison to specification.
  • Mechanical setup, test and dynamic balance of components.
  • Performs electrical in-process verification of compliance to specifications.
  • Calibrates and maintains electrical test equipment including development of electronic databases, standards, work instructions and procedures.
